Summary

CVE-2024-28255 is a critical vulnerability in the OpenMetadata platform, affecting its API authentication mechanism. The vulnerability allows an attacker to bypass JWT token validation by manipulating path parameters in a request. This means that the attacker can reach any arbitrary endpoint without proper authentication, including endpoints that may lead to arbitrary SpEL (Spring Expression Language) injection. The impact of this vulnerability is high, as it compromises both the confidentiality and integrity of the system. To remediate this issue, it is recommended to update OpenMetadata to a patched version that addresses this vulnerability.
